Seznam k datům: Průvodce datovými řetězci

V tomto pruvodci se podíváme na seznamy k termínům. Objevíte jak pracovat datovými řetězci, aby byly efektivní.

  • Ignorujte na náročné systémy
  • Zjistěte jak vytvořit vlastní popisy k datům
  • Naučte se předávání dat s aplikacemi

Tento průvodce je určen pro školáky.

Fundamental Structures for Programmers

Every skilled programmer must possess a solid understanding of various data structures. These fundamental concepts form the core of any program. A proficient grasp of data structures allows programmers to optimally organize information, optimize program performance, and construct robust applications. Understanding common data structures like arrays, linked lists, stacks, queues, trees, and graphs is essential for any aspiring programmer.

  • Familiarize yourself with the characteristics of each data structure.
  • Implement these structures in your coding endeavors to build real-world applications.
  • Stay updated about advanced data structures and their implementations in the ever-evolving field of computer science.

Vývoj seznamu k datům v Pythonu

V Pythonu existují různé metody pro připracení seznamů k datům. Jednou z nejčastějších je použití funkcí jako je insert() pro vložení jednotlivých prvků do seznamu. Další možnost je vytvořit seznam z seznamu dat pomocí příkazů jako je split() nebo map(). Volba nejvhodnější metody závisí na druhu vstupních dat a požadovaném konečném stavu.

  • Využití iterací
  • Pracování dat v seznamu
  • Strukturální uspořádání dat pro další zpracování

Optimization Lists to Data in C++

Working efficiently with lists of data in C++ is paramount for achieving optimal performance. Adaptive data structures like vectors and lists offer powerful tools for managing sequential information. However, merely implementing these structures isn't sufficient; we must also focus on optimizing their usage. Careful selection of algorithms and data access techniques can significantly improve the speed and memory efficiency of your C++ applications.

A crucial aspect of list optimization lies in understanding the specific operations you frequently perform. Are you accessing elements by index or value? Do you need to insert items at various positions, or are eliminations more common?

By understanding your application's needs, you can customize the most suitable data structures and algorithms. For instance, if rapid element access by index is critical, a vector might be preferable over a doubly linked list. Conversely, if insertions and deletions occur frequently, a deque could offer better performance.

Remember that pre-allocating your lists appropriately can prevent costly memory reallocations as your application grows. Utilizing built-in C++ features like iterators and range-based for loops can also simplify list manipulation operations.

Finally, always benchmark your code to identify potential bottlenecks. Profiling tools can reveal areas where list operations are consuming excessive time or resources, allowing you to target your optimization efforts for maximum impact.

Zpracování seznamů k datům v databázových systémech

Seznamy jsou vhodným nástrojem pro ukládání dat v databázových systémech. Mohou být vybaveny k uložení mnoha druhů typů dat, jako jsou název uživatelů, soubory o výrobcích a další relevantních informací.

S pomocí použití seznamů v databázových systémech je možné obdržet vyšší výkonu a efektivnosti.

  • Výhody seznamů je jejich skutečnost.
  • Je možné v nich uložit početných datových typů.
  • S pomocí seznamů lze implementovat rychlé dotazy.

Ulehčení práce s daty pomocí seznamů k datům

Práce se mnohastymi datovými sadami může být náročná a náročná. Seznamy k datům nabízejí efektivní způsob, jak organizovat data a usnadnit práci s nimi. {TímtoTakto click here metodou můžete usnadnit přístup k datům, zjistit informace rychleji a provádět analýzy.

  • {JednímJednou z adaptabilita.
  • {Možná si vybrat strukturu seznamu a překreslit ji vašim potřebám.
  • {Seznamk k datům mohou být efektivní pro ukládání a nabídka dat.

Leave a Reply

Your email address will not be published. Required fields are marked *